fabric
body: 84% polyamide, 16% elastane
body liner: 95% cotton, 5% elastane
gusset 1 (wicking): 95% cotton, 5% elastane
gusset 2 (absorbent): 96% cotton, 4% elastane
gusset 3 (barrier): 100% polyester, coated w/ breathable PU
Our underwear is certified according to STANDARD 100 by OEKO-TEX:registered: [20.HUS.04850 | HOHENSTEIN HTTI]
care instructions
Wash before wearing. Hand wash or machine wash cold on a delicate cycle. Do not use bleach or fabric softener. Hang dry — no ironing please!

Thinx is machine-washable and reusable period-absorbing underwear — providing a more sustainable alternative to single-use disposable products. Thinx underwear for periods is designed in a range of absorbencies, from lightest to super, to support every stage of your flow. Every pair of Thinx period-absorbing underwear features our signature, innovative built-in technology — a moisture-wicking top layer, an absorbent core layer, and an outermost leak-resistant barrier. Our absorbency levels range from lightest (1 regular tampon worth of flow) to Super (5 regular tampons worth of flow), so there is a style for every day of your cycle. We recommend trying Thinx period-absorbing underwear for the first time at home so you can see how they best work for your ~flow~. If you feel damp or notice your flow spreading to the seams, it may be time to change into a new pair. Across all absorbencies, the gusset positioning within the underwear varies by style. However, generally, the gusset sits under the entire front of the vulva, widened significantly at the front and rear for leak protection and with extra length in the back — covering the surface area necessary to absorb your flow and prevent leaks.
Every flow is different! You can wear period-absorbing underwear for as long as your flow will allow. And of course, the style you wear also plays a factor, as some underwear styles are more absorbent than others. We measure our underwear for periods by absorbency, with our highest absorbency styles holding up to 5 tampons worth of flow. For some customers, they will last the whole day, and others may need to carry an extra pair of Thinx period underwear as a backup. If you feel damp or notice your flow spreading to the seams, that is an indicator you should change into a fresh pair. We recommend following the hip measurement to find the most accurate size. Be sure to measure your hips at their widest point, derriere included! We recommend sizing up in underwear styles that fit below the natural waist. Check the fit details of each underwear style via our size chart. The underwear should fit snugly but not so tight that it becomes uncomfortable.
Our underwear is super simple to care for: make sure to wash before your first wear and with the rest of your laundry after each use. Hand wash or machine wash cold on a delicate cycle. Your other clothes will be fine, we promise! Just make sure to steer clear of fabric softener and bleach. And, last but not least, hang dry to keep your undies at max performance. Do not iron.
